Another way to use JavaScript in an iOS app is through a hybrid framework. These frameworks allow developers to write a Javascript app using HTML and CSS, but run it in browser view on mobile devices. This is a great solution for many people. However, it’s important to note that native plug-ins are required to access the device’s hardware features. These can be complex to create and are often full of bugs.

Can I Use JavaScript in Xcode?

Can I Use JavaScript in Xcode? The short answer is yes. JavaScript has its own environment in the iOS environment and runs into a virtual machine. This virtual machine is referred to as a JSVirtualMachine class. There can be more than one virtual machine running in an app, but they cannot exchange data directly.
